4. Legal Recourse

The unauthorized creation of a fake Instagram account utilizing another person’s images may prompt consideration of legal recourse. The potential avenues for legal action depend on the specific circumstances, including the extent of harm caused and the laws in the relevant jurisdiction. The following outlines potential legal actions a victim might consider.

  • Cease and Desist Letter

    The initial step often involves sending a cease and desist letter to the individual responsible for the fake account. This letter formally demands the immediate removal of the fraudulent profile and cessation of any further impersonation. While a cease and desist letter does not guarantee compliance, it serves as a formal notification and can be a prerequisite for further legal action. If the identity of the imposter is unknown, this step becomes problematic.

  • Defamation Lawsuit

    If the fake Instagram account has been used to post false or defamatory statements that harm the victim’s reputation, a defamation lawsuit may be warranted. To succeed in a defamation claim, the victim must demonstrate that the statements made were false, published to a third party, and caused actual harm, such as loss of employment or damage to personal relationships. The burden of proof in defamation cases can be substantial.

  • Right of Publicity Claim

    In some jurisdictions, individuals have a legal right to control the commercial use of their name and likeness. If the fake Instagram account is being used for commercial purposes, such as advertising or endorsement, without the victim’s consent, a right of publicity claim may be viable. This type of claim focuses on the unauthorized exploitation of the victim’s identity for financial gain.

  • Cyberstalking or Harassment Charges

    If the creation of the fake Instagram account is part of a pattern of harassment or cyberstalking, criminal charges may be pursued. Cyberstalking laws vary by jurisdiction, but they generally prohibit using electronic communications to harass, threaten, or intimidate another person. To pursue criminal charges, the victim must typically demonstrate a credible threat of harm or a pattern of repeated harassment.

The decision to pursue legal recourse should be carefully considered, taking into account the potential costs, time commitment, and likelihood of success. Consulting with an attorney experienced in internet law and defamation is advisable to assess the available options and determine the best course of action. The pursuit of legal remedies highlights the serious consequences associated with online impersonation and the importance of protecting one’s digital identity.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following addresses frequently encountered questions regarding the unauthorized creation of Instagram accounts utilizing another individual’s photographs. These answers are designed to provide clarity and guidance on understanding the implications and addressing the situation.

Question 1: What immediate steps should be taken upon discovering a fraudulent Instagram account using personal photographs?

The initial action should be reporting the fake account directly to Instagram through the platform’s reporting mechanism. Simultaneously, document all evidence related to the fraudulent profile, including screenshots and any interactions with the account.

Question 2: Can legal action be pursued against the individual responsible for creating the fake Instagram account?

The viability of legal action depends on several factors, including the jurisdiction and the extent of harm caused by the fake account. Consulting with an attorney specializing in internet law is recommended to assess the available legal options.

Question 3: What are the potential financial risks associated with a fraudulent Instagram account using personal photographs?

The fake account could be used for phishing scams, soliciting funds from contacts under false pretenses, or promoting fraudulent investment opportunities. Vigilance and skepticism are essential when interacting with any suspicious requests or offers originating from the account.

Question 4: How can the potential damage to one’s reputation be mitigated in the event of a fake Instagram account?

Proactive reputation management strategies include alerting contacts to the existence of the fake account, correcting any misinformation disseminated by the imposter, and strengthening one’s own online presence to counter the negative impact.

Question 5: What measures can be taken to prevent the creation of fake Instagram accounts in the first place?

Strengthening privacy settings on social media profiles, limiting the availability of personal photographs online, and regularly monitoring one’s online presence can reduce the risk of identity theft and unauthorized account creation.

Question 6: What recourse is available if Instagram fails to remove the reported fake account?

If Instagram’s response is deemed inadequate, alternative options may include contacting legal counsel to explore further legal action or filing a complaint with consumer protection agencies or relevant regulatory bodies.

Mitigating Risks

The unauthorized creation of a fraudulent Instagram profile using personal photographs presents a significant threat to individual identity and reputation. Implementing preventative measures is crucial in mitigating this risk. The following provides key strategies to minimize exposure and protect personal information.

Tip 1: Review and Adjust Privacy Settings: Regularly examine Instagram’s privacy settings to restrict access to personal information. Set profiles to private, limiting visibility to approved followers only. This reduces the pool of potential sources for image theft.

Tip 2: Limit Photo Sharing on Public Platforms: Exercise caution when sharing photographs on publicly accessible websites or social media platforms. Even seemingly innocuous images can be harvested and utilized to create convincing fake profiles.

Tip 3: Use Watermarks on Images: Applying watermarks to personal photographs can deter unauthorized use. Watermarks can be subtle, yet effective in rendering images less appealing for fraudulent purposes. Consider the strategic placement to deter removal.

Tip 4: Monitor Online Presence Regularly: Conduct periodic searches using image search engines to identify instances where personal photographs may have been used without consent. Setting up Google Alerts with one’s name can also provide notifications of new online mentions.

Tip 5: Be Wary of Phishing Attempts: Exercise caution when interacting with unsolicited messages or requests for personal information on social media platforms. Imposters often use phishing tactics to gather data for creating convincing fake accounts.

Tip 6: Enable Two-Factor Authentication: Employing two-factor authentication on Instagram provides an additional layer of security, making it more difficult for unauthorized individuals to access and compromise the account. This reduces the risk of associated image theft.

The strategies outlined provide a proactive approach to safeguarding personal information and minimizing the risk of fraudulent Instagram account creation. Consistent implementation of these measures strengthens personal security in the digital landscape.
